1. Whimsical Woodland Nook
Imagine stepping into a magical forest, right in your classroom! This design wraps your space in earthy tones, creating a serene yet engaging atmosphere. We’re talking about bringing the outdoors in, but with a playful, crafted twist.
Color Palette:
- Moss green, sky blue, forest brown, with pops of blush pink and sunny yellow.
Key Crafts:
- Paper tree cutouts with textured bark details for walls.
- Felt animal puppets (foxes, owls, bunnies) peeking from shelves.
- Yarn-wrapped branches strung with fairy lights for a cozy corner.
This vibe is perfect for younger grades or a reading corner, fostering a sense of calm and wonder. Seriously, who wouldn’t want to learn here?

4. Under the Sea Adventure
Dive deep into an ocean of learning with this serene yet captivating classroom theme. Blues and greens dominate, creating a calming atmosphere, while playful sea creatures add a touch of whimsy. It’s like a peaceful aquarium, but better!
Color Palette:
- Shades of ocean blue, seafoam green, sandy beige, with pops of coral pink.
Key Crafts:
- Floating jellyfish lanterns made from paper bowls and streamers.
- Paper plate fish and starfish cutouts with glitter accents.
- A bulletin board transformed into a vibrant coral reef using scrunched tissue paper.
Ideal for fostering a sense of calm and exploration, this theme works wonders for science lessons or just a tranquil learning space. Trust me, it’s a splash hit!

18. Upcycled Wonderland
Celebrate sustainability and creativity with a classroom design made entirely from recycled and repurposed materials. This theme proves that beauty and innovation can come from unexpected places. Reduce, reuse, re-decorate!
Color Palette:
- A mix of earthy tones with bright, unexpected pops of color from various materials.
Key Crafts:
- Egg carton flowers painted in vibrant hues.
- Plastic bottle wind chimes or sculptures.
- Magazine collage murals or paper bead garlands.
This eco-conscious theme is perfect for teaching environmental responsibility and inspiring ingenuity in students of all ages. It’s a masterpiece of resourcefulness!
